I love this trail is so quiet and pretty. Spring time and summer time, the many wild flowers around and the birds singing are delightful. You can bring your bike or just walk or run.
I think this is the best running, biking, walking trail in the area. I love that it is so shady under all the trees. With the Memphis heat the shade makes my workout bearable. The trail is wide enough for two way traffic and paved so that it is smooth.

“Probably 15 or so parking spaces available, a long with a security camera in the parking lot.”
“The trail is wide enough for two way traffic and paved so that it is smooth.”
“There is a giant bridge to go across, there is a public bathroom, and some areas go near traffic.”
“On the other side of the river the trails are single track and can be muddy, but also amazing.”
